Introduction

A coupon code is a sequence of alphanumeric characters that consumers use to obtain a discount or special offer when making a purchase. Coupon codes are commonly presented in print or digital form, and they can be redeemed at a point of sale, online, or through mobile applications. The primary function of a coupon code is to incentivize purchase, promote brand awareness, and facilitate targeted marketing campaigns. Coupon codes are typically associated with a specific product, category, or transaction, and they may impose restrictions such as minimum purchase amounts, limited timeframes, or usage limits. As a tool in retail, marketing, and consumer economics, coupon codes have evolved from simple paper vouchers to sophisticated digital assets integrated into e‑commerce ecosystems.

History and Development

Early Coupon Systems

Coupon systems date back to the late 19th century, when retailers issued paper vouchers to encourage repeat purchases. Early coupons were often distributed by direct mail, in newspapers, or through loyalty card programs. The primary purpose was to provide a tangible incentive for consumers to choose one brand over competitors. During the early 20th century, coupon catalogs became popular, allowing customers to select items for discounted purchase at a future date. These early coupons were manually processed, requiring the consumer to present the voucher at a cashier for verification.

Transition to Digital Coupons

The advent of the internet and e‑commerce in the late 1990s and early 2000s marked a turning point for coupon codes. Digital coupons replaced paper vouchers, allowing automatic calculation of discounts during checkout. The use of alphanumeric codes became standard, as it provided a simple, secure method to apply discounts without physical handling. Digital couponing enabled retailers to target specific consumer segments based on browsing behavior, purchase history, or demographic data. The proliferation of smartphones further expanded coupon usage, with mobile applications allowing consumers to scan QR codes or tap to apply discounts directly in the app.

Key Concepts and Definitions

Coupon Code

A coupon code is a unique identifier that triggers a discount, promotion, or other benefit when entered into an online or offline transaction. Coupon codes can be randomly generated or structured to convey specific information, such as the discount percentage or campaign name. The code is typically associated with a set of rules that determine its applicability, validity period, and usage limits.

Types of Coupon Codes

  • Percentage‑off codes, e.g., 20% off.
  • Fixed‑amount codes, e.g., $10 off.
  • Buy‑one‑get‑one (BOGO) codes.
  • Free shipping codes.
  • Tiered or conditional codes that require a minimum purchase.
  • Multi‑use codes, which can be redeemed multiple times by the same consumer.
  • Single‑use codes, limited to one redemption.

Validity and Expiration

Coupon codes typically have a defined validity window, either specified by a start and end date or by a number of days from the date of issuance. Once the expiration date passes, the code is no longer accepted. Some coupon systems allow dynamic expiration based on inventory levels or marketing calendars. In addition to time constraints, codes may be restricted by the number of times they can be redeemed, either globally or per consumer.

Redemption Channels

Redemption can occur via multiple channels: in‑store point of sale, online checkout, mobile application, or a combination. Each channel may require different verification methods. For example, online checkout typically relies on automated code validation, whereas in‑store redemption may involve manual entry by a cashier or scanning of a QR code. Cross‑channel redemption often necessitates synchronized backend systems to enforce usage limits and track consumption.

Technology and Implementation

Code Generation Algorithms

Coupon codes are generated using algorithms that balance uniqueness, security, and user convenience. Randomized alphanumeric strings provide a high entropy space, reducing the risk of brute‑force discovery. Some systems embed metadata into the code, such as a hash of the campaign ID or expiration date, enabling quick validation without database lookup. Structured codes often use prefixes to indicate the promotion type, facilitating both human readability and automated parsing. Advanced implementations may incorporate checksum digits or cryptographic signatures to detect tampering.

Database Structures

The backend of a coupon system requires a relational or NoSQL database to store code attributes, usage history, and associated constraints. Typical tables include: CouponCode (code, campaign ID, type, discount value, expiration, usage limits), ConsumerCoupon (consumer ID, code, status), and RedemptionLog (timestamp, transaction ID, code). Indexing on the code field ensures rapid lookup during checkout. Many systems also maintain an audit trail to support fraud detection and compliance reporting.

Integration with E‑commerce Platforms

Coupon codes are integrated into e‑commerce platforms through application programming interfaces (APIs) or native modules. The integration allows the checkout process to validate the code, calculate the discount, and apply it to the cart total. Integration layers handle edge cases such as cart incompatibility, overlapping promotions, and dynamic pricing. Advanced platforms expose developer APIs for custom coupon logic, enabling third‑party developers to build extensions that manage coupon distribution or reporting.

Security and Fraud Prevention

Security is a critical consideration for coupon systems. Measures include limiting the number of attempts to enter a code, implementing rate‑limiting, and using CAPTCHA to deter bots. Fraud prevention also involves monitoring redemption patterns for anomalies, such as high-volume usage by a single IP address or multiple redemptions by the same account in a short period. In addition, coupon codes are often stored encrypted at rest, and database access is controlled via role‑based permissions.

Applications and Use Cases

Retail and E‑commerce

In physical retail, coupon codes are commonly distributed through mailers, loyalty cards, or promotional displays. Customers present the code at the cashier, who scans or inputs it to apply the discount. Online retailers embed coupon codes in email newsletters, product pages, or checkout pop‑ups. These codes often target specific categories, such as "New Season Sale" or "Clearance," and can be tied to inventory management systems to drive stock clearance.

Service Industries

Coupon codes are not limited to goods; they are widely used in services such as travel, entertainment, and health care. Airlines offer discount codes for flight tickets, hotels provide promo codes for room bookings, and streaming services use codes for subscription discounts. In these contexts, coupon codes may also include additional benefits such as free upgrades or priority boarding.

Marketing Campaigns

Coupon codes serve as a key component of marketing campaigns. By tracking which codes are redeemed, marketers can attribute sales to specific channels, such as social media ads, influencer collaborations, or email marketing. Campaigns often include limited‑time offers to create urgency, and the performance metrics derived from coupon usage inform future strategy adjustments.

Customer Retention and Loyalty

Retailers integrate coupon codes into loyalty programs to reward repeat customers. Points earned can be converted into coupon codes, providing a sense of value. Loyalty members may receive exclusive codes that unlock higher discounts or early access to sales. This approach fosters brand affinity and increases the likelihood of repeat transactions.

Economic Impact and Analysis

Pricing Strategies

Coupon codes enable dynamic pricing strategies. Retailers can adjust discounts to respond to demand fluctuations, inventory levels, or competitive pressures. For instance, a high‑volume retailer may use coupons to move excess stock or to test the price elasticity of a new product. By analyzing redemption data, companies can refine discount thresholds to maximize revenue while preserving margins.

Consumer Behavior

Studies consistently show that coupon codes influence consumer purchase decisions. Coupons can lower the perceived cost barrier, increase perceived value, and encourage trial of unfamiliar products. However, excessive coupon usage may also erode brand value, as consumers come to expect discounts and reduce willingness to pay full price. The optimal balance involves offering coupons strategically to target segments while preserving the premium positioning of core products.

Market Penetration

Coupon codes serve as a tool for entering new markets. A new entrant can distribute coupons to attract price‑sensitive consumers and gain a foothold in a competitive landscape. As market penetration increases, the distribution of coupon codes may shift from mass to segmented approaches, focusing on high‑value customers or specific geographic regions.

Consumer Protection Laws

Consumer protection authorities regulate coupon practices to prevent deceptive or unfair marketing. Regulations may require clear disclosure of coupon terms, including the discount amount, expiration date, and any usage restrictions. In some jurisdictions, failure to honor a coupon after it is advertised can result in consumer complaints or legal action. Retailers must maintain accurate records of coupon terms and redemption to demonstrate compliance.

Data Privacy Issues

Coupon systems often collect consumer data, such as email addresses, purchase history, or device identifiers. Under data protection regulations, such as the General Data Protection Regulation (GDPR) and the California Consumer Privacy Act (CCPA), retailers must obtain consent for data usage and provide mechanisms for data deletion. Coupon platforms must secure data at rest and in transit, employing encryption and access controls to mitigate privacy breaches.

International Variations

Legal requirements for coupon usage differ across countries. Some nations impose limits on discount percentages or restrict the use of coupon codes in certain product categories, such as pharmaceuticals. Additionally, cross‑border e‑commerce transactions require compliance with multiple regulatory frameworks, complicating coupon distribution and enforcement. Retailers operating globally must adapt coupon strategies to local legal contexts.

Challenges and Limitations

Fraudulent Activity

Coupon codes are vulnerable to fraud. Users may share codes publicly, enabling unauthorized redemption. Automated bots can attempt to guess valid codes en masse, a phenomenon known as coupon scraping. Retailers implement fraud detection algorithms that flag abnormal redemption patterns, such as simultaneous use by multiple accounts or excessive use in a short timeframe.

Complexity and User Experience

Overly complex coupon structures can frustrate consumers. If codes are difficult to find, input, or apply, users may abandon the purchase. Clear communication of terms, straightforward redemption steps, and consistent behavior across channels improve user satisfaction. Additionally, mismatches between expected and actual discounts can erode trust.

Technology Adoption Barriers

Smaller retailers may lack the technical resources to implement sophisticated coupon systems. The integration of coupon platforms with legacy point‑of‑sale systems can require significant investment. Open‑source or cloud‑based solutions exist, but they often lack customization features required by niche industries. Consequently, many small businesses rely on simple paper coupons or manual discount processes.

AI‑Driven Personalization

Artificial intelligence models can analyze consumer behavior to generate highly personalized coupon offers. Machine learning algorithms predict the likelihood of conversion for each customer, optimizing discount amounts and delivery channels. Personalization reduces the risk of coupon fatigue while increasing the return on marketing spend.

Blockchain‑Based Verification

Blockchain technology offers immutable record‑keeping for coupon issuance and redemption. Smart contracts can enforce usage limits, expiration, and exclusivity automatically. Distributed ledgers also provide transparency to consumers, allowing them to verify the authenticity of a coupon code before use. Early adopters in the luxury goods sector experiment with blockchain‑based couponing to protect against counterfeit promotions.

Omni‑Channel Couponing

Retailers are converging coupon strategies across physical and digital touchpoints. A single code may be valid in an online store, a mobile app, and a brick‑and‑mortar outlet, allowing consumers to transition seamlessly between channels. This omni‑channel approach enhances flexibility and encourages cross‑channel traffic. The underlying systems require robust synchronization to prevent double redemption or channel conflicts.
